I must be the only guy that hates sand. It has caused me nothing but problems and for 25 bucks a ton those are problems I don't need. the cows I have on mats do great. I bed with fine chopped corn stalks and cell count is always under 150. I bet most guys that say mats didn't work is because they had small stalls. I have a 4 row tail to tail barn with 10 foot stall beds and neck rail at 50 inches high. sand bedding is definitely more forgiving to poor stall designs. As far as lame cows I don't care what anyone says. if you got Holsteins you are going to have some lame cows all the time. Especially if you have warts. Once you have them you will always have them. sand aint going to stop them.
